** No Onward Chain** A beautifully presented three bedroom bungalow occupying a generous plot within the desirable village of Barnardiston. The property enjoys versatile living accommodation, is set back from the road and presents an excellent opportunity for those seeking a comfortable home in a picturesque location.
Barnardiston is a village and parish in the West Suffolk district of Suffolk, England. The village is located about four miles north-east of Haverhill off the A143.
